Fishing Glacier National Park: 2nd Edition (Falcon Guidebook) Fishing Glacier National Park: 2nd Edition (Falcon Guidebook)
   by Russ Schneider

Fly Fishing Gear.Info Comments
This is the best all-around book about fishing in Glacier National Park, both fly fishing and spin fishing. It covers all the various lakes and rivers within the park, listing those with fish and those that don't. It also provides general camping and hiking information to reach the various backcountry waters in Glacier National Park.

The Yellowstone Fly-Fishing Guide The Yellowstone Fly-Fishing Guide
   by Craig Matthews

Fly Fishing Gear.Info Comments
Highly recommended! This is the most comprehensive and complete Yellowstone National Park fishing guidebook available. This fly fishing book covers all the waters in Yellowstone, including the obscure and out of the way backcountry lakes and streams.
Excellent information is provided on both where to fish and what to use once there. An angler who will be visiting Yellowstone National Park to fly fish, especially in the backcountry, should be armed with this book to avoid fly fishing in "fishless lakes" or missing prime backcountry fishing locations.

Yellowstone Fishes : Ecology, History, and Angling in the Park Yellowstone Fishes : Ecology, History, and Angling in the Park
    by John Varley

Book Description from Amazon.Com
A comprehensive guide to Yellowstone fish and their habitat. This edition includes much new material, including the impact on fish of the 1988 forest fires and the introduction of non-native species; an expanded chapter on angling; updated taxonomy; and an assessment of recent management policies. It also provides an overview of the entire Yellowstone watershed, from backcountry streams to the major rivers and lakes.
